Hop aboard our climate controlled luxury minibus and take a journey to the new culinary center of the Big Apple, where food and dining trends are dispersed to the rest of the country, in Brooklyn. And with this half-day tour, you can take a big bite out of it. From old ethnic enclaves to the latest hipster 'hoods, Brooklyn's dining scene is both diverse and cutting edge. Munch on pierogies in Polish-dominated Greenpoint and tasty Mediterranean fare in Williamsburg. Chocolate bon-bons in DUMBO.
You’ll also get to enjoy freshly made empanadas in Park Slope, coal brick oven pizza in the Gowanus area and finish off with a cannoli in Carroll Gardens.
This guided bus and eating tour of New York's coolest and tastiest borough is ideal for foodies and the people who love them.
You can even end your Brooklyn adventure by walking back to Manhattan across the most famous Brooklyn landmark, the Brooklyn Bridge, or ride back on the coach to the starting point of the tour in Greenwich Village.
